Median household income is $75,000, near the U.S. median near $78,000. Around 22% of renters are cost-burdened. About 1,725 people live here, median age 42. Home values center near $231,300, an affordability ratio of 2.9× — accessible. 14.3% of residents fall below the poverty threshold. Educational attainment sits at 20% bachelor's-or-above. DLRadar's demographic-stress index for the area reads 26/100. The vacancy rate is 5.8%. The ZIP holds roughly 791 housing units. Owners hold 86% of homes, renters 14%.
